**CONDUCTIVE POLYMER HYBRID ALUMINUM ELECTROLYTIC CAPACITORS** **==> picture [80 x 26] intentionally omitted <==** **----- Start of picture text -----**<br> GYD<br>**----- End of picture text -----**<br> Chip Type, 150°C High Reliability High Reliability, Low ESR,High ripple current. Long life of 1000 hours at 150°C. Compliant to the RoHS directive (2011/65/EU,(EU)2015/863). AEC-Q200 Qualified.
